English Muffin Recipe

English muffin recipe is perfect for making soft, chewy, and golden homemade muffins with a lightly crisp exterior. These classic muffins are cooked on a griddle and taste much better than store-bought versions. They are delicious served with butter, jam, honey, or cream cheese for breakfast or snacks. Ingredients

  • 1 cup milk
  • 2 tablespoons white sugar
  • 1 cup warm water
  • 1 package active dry yeast
  • 6 cups all-purpose flour
  • ¼ cup melted shortening
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• ¼ cup cornmeal

Directions

  • Warm the milk in a saucepan until small bubbles appear around the edges.
  • Remove from heat and stir in sugar until dissolved.
  • Allow the milk mixture to cool until lukewarm.
  • In a small bowl, combine warm water and yeast.
  • Let the yeast mixture stand for about 10 minutes until creamy.
  • In a large bowl, combine the milk mixture, yeast mixture, 3 cups flour, and melted shortening.
  • Beat until smooth.
  • Add salt and the remaining flour gradually to form a soft dough.
  • Knead the dough until smooth and soft.
  • Place dough in a greased bowl, cover, and let rise for about 1 hour until doubled in size.
  • Punch down the dough and roll it out on a lightly floured surface to about ½-inch thickness.
  • Cut out rounds using a biscuit cutter or glass.
  • Sprinkle cornmeal onto a surface and place dough rounds on top.
  • Dust the tops with additional cornmeal.
  • Cover and let rise for another 30 minutes.
  • Heat a greased griddle over medium heat.
  • Cook muffins for about 10 minutes on each side until golden brown.
  • Split and toast before serving if desired.

Preparation Details

  • Prep Time: 25 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Additional Time: 1 hour 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 2 hours 15 minutes
  • Servings: 18
  • Yield: 18 English muffins
